Best 11692 New York Public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 929 students in 11692, NY.
The top ranked public preschools in 11692, NY are Ps/ms 42 R Vernam and Goldie Maple Academy.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 11692 have an average math proficiency score of 14% (versus the New York public pre school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 46% (versus the 54% statewide average). Pre schools in 11692, NY have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New York public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 98%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the New York public preschool average of 63% (majority Hispanic).
